Although Expo 2010 Shanghai is made up mainly of the pavilions of more than 190 countries, the Chinese government did not pass up the opportunity of conceiving five large thematic pavilions that condense the exposition’s main theme from different perspectives: “City People”, “City Life”, City Planet”, “City Future” and “City Footprint”.
The thematic pavilions are located in Zone B of the closed area of the exposition site, to the west of Expo Boulevard. Their forms are inspired by the architectural style of ancient Shanghai. With an area of 80,000 square meters and a basement of 40,000 the thematic pavilions are specially designed to be environmental-friendly.
